Intellectual Property Law
Intellectual property law is a branch of law created to protect ideas with monetary value. All kinds of ideas, inventions, and designs can be the subject of intellectual property law. And often these ideas need to be protected.
Intellectual property law is divided into two parts copyright and industrial property rights. In order to protect industrial property rights, the relevant invention must be registered. Registration is required for patents and branding.
